Billie Eilish’s brother and right hand producer Finneas spoke with Mr Porter in a Tuesday (Dec. 19) interview and revealed that his sister’s next album is “85 percent done.”
While the percentage offers a concrete update for fans, Finneas noted that the process of creating the album was not an easy one.
“I don’t think Billie was particularly sure about how she actually felt about the things we were trying to write about,” he explained .“Making a thing that you feel really connected to – it can really evade you.”
Finneas, who works with Eilish often on songwriting, additionally shared that mapping out the time between his own busy schedule for writing was difficult as he performed 88 shows in a year’s time: “I think I got a little rusty. And that was scary. It was discouraging to realize that if I take time off, my songwriting muscle atrophies. I had to get back in shape.”
